
Office
629 Euclid Avenue
Cleveland, OH 44114
- For Lease
- 5,697 SF
- $17.75 SF/YR
Property Details:
- Listing Type: Lease
- Primary Use: Office
- Building: 292,477 SF
- Office: 292,477 SF
- Available: 5,697 SF
- Lease Rate PSF: $17.75 SF/YR
- Parcel Number: 101-27-036
- Sub Market: Downtown/CBD Area